I have four 3560G's on my LAN which run our production environment/domain from the default VLAN 1. The ports between the switches which connect each switch to another are trunked. What I'm trying to accomplish here is create another VLAN which is totally separate from the main VLAN 1 so each cannot talk to one another. The default VLAN (or VLAN 1) is 192.168.252.x. The VLAN 2 subnet will be 192.168.250.x.
The 192.168.252.1 gateway you see in the configs is our ISA server which is connected to the outside world. The ISA server is connected to a port on SWITCH-B. Only VLAN 1 should be able to hit the ISA server and Internet.
Here's the layout...
Switch-A:
- Port 49 trunked to port 49 on Switch-C
- VLAN 1 192.168.252.51
- VLAN 2
Switch-B:
- Port 49 trunked to port 50 on Switch-C
- VLAN 1 192.168.252.52
- VLAN 2
Switch-C:
- Port 49 trunked to port 49 on Switch-A
- Port 50 trunked to port 49 on Switch-B
- Port 51 trunked to port 49 on Switch-D
- VLAN 1 192.168.252.53
- VLAN 2 192.168.250.53
Switch-D:
- Port 49 trunked to port 51 on Switch-C
- VLAN 1 192.168.252.54
- VLAN 2
Is it possible to have a client on Switch-A talk to a client on Switch-D from VLAN 2 without clients from VLAN 1 and VLAN 2 being able to talk each other? Basically, I would like for the 252 subnet (VLAN 1) to be on one domain and the 250 (VLAN 2) be on another domain and not see each other.
